The Search
Behind my eyes in a happy place, I search for a heart, not a face I feel myself burn I'm consumed in flames Happiness, love cannot be replaced She doesn't understand where trust comes from, She flees from love and loaded guns. To risk it all Is to come undone In agony she turns and runs. I'll disappear in a cloud of smoke Wearing the night sky as a cloak I don't ask for the world Just to be fixed, not broke In a world that destroyed my all of my hope
